CONTROL SEQUENCE A3
COOLING WITH ON/OFF HOT WATER HEAT (CONTINUOUS
OPERATION)
Sequence of Operation:
Fan runs continuously, providing constant volume to the space.
With room temperature at set point, unit delivers minimum cooling airflow and maximum
induced plenum air. On a rise in room temperature, the thermostat regulates the
controller/actuator to increase primary airflow.
As more cold air is supplied to the fan section, less warm air is induced from the ceiling plenum.
When the room temperature exceeds the setpoint by 2°F (1.1°C) or more, primary
airflow is maintained at the maximum setting. The maximum setting is usually the same
as the total fan volume setting.
On a decrease in room temperature, the thermostat regulates the controller/actuator to
decrease the airflow and as less cold air is supplied to the fan section, more warm air is
induced from the ceiling plenum. If room temperature continues to drop, minimum
primary airflow is maintained and at 0.8°F (0.4°C) below setpoint, the on/off hot water
valve is energized.
An increase in room temperature de-activates the heat at 0.4°F (0.2°C) below setpoint.
Primary airflow is held constant in accordance with thermostat demand. Any changes in
duct air velocity due to static pressure fluctuations are sensed and compensated for,
resulting in pressure independent control.
Notes:
1. Cooling and heating setpoints can be adjusted to be within 1°F (0.55°C) from each other.
(Minimum and maximum primary airflow limits are adjusted underneath the thermostat cover).
2. Constant volume series terminal fans should be interlocked to be energized ahead of
or when the central system fan starts, to prevent backflow of primary air into the ceiling
plenum and to prevent possible backward rotation of the terminal fan.
